Ajax获取XmlHttpRequest对象的方法,兼容IE、火狐。用来与服务器进行通信。
来源:互联网 发布:淘宝寄快递在哪里 编辑:程序博客网 时间:2024/06/09 19:00
方法一:
function ajaxFunction(){
var xmlHttp;try{ // Firefox, Opera 8.0+, Safari
xmlHttp=new XMLHttpRequest();
}
catch (e){
try{// Internet Explorer
x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
}
catch (e){
try{
x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
}
catch (e){}
}
}
return xmlHttp;
}
方法二:
function getXMLHttpRequest(){
var xmlHttpReq=null;
if (window.ActiveXObject) {//IE浏览器创建XMLHttpRequest对象
xmlHttpReq = new ActiveXObject("MSXML2.XMLHTTP.3.0");
}else if(window.XMLHttpRequest){
xmlHttpReq = new XMLHttpRequest();
}
return xmlHttpReq;
}
方法三:
function getXMLHttpRequest() {
var xmlHttpReq=null;
if (window.XMLHttpRequest) {//Mozilla 浏览器
xmlHttpReq = new XMLHttpRequest();
}else {
if (window.ActiveXObject) {//IE 浏览器
try {
xmlHttpReq = new ActiveXObject("Microsoft.XMLHTTP");
}
catch (e) {
try {//IE 浏览器
xmlHttpReq = new ActiveXObject("Msxml2.XMLHTTP");
}
catch (e) {
}
}
}
}
return xmlHttpReq;
}
- Ajax获取XmlHttpRequest对象的方法,兼容IE、火狐。用来与服务器进行通信。
- ajax中获取XMLHttpRequest对象的方法(IE/Firefox/chrome)
- ajax获取XMLHttpRequest对象的通用方法
- 兼容ie 谷歌 火狐的获取焦点失去焦点方法
- IE和火狐兼容的AJAX写法
- IE和火狐兼容的AJAX写法
- ajax XMLHttpRequest 对象 的属性与方法
- XMLHttpRequest对象来和服务器进行通信
- 获取事件目标对象的位置坐标或者鼠标位置坐标(兼容IE和火狐)
- AJAX 一个IE和Firefox兼容的XMLHttpRequest
- IE与火狐关于获取按键不兼容处理
- IE与火狐关于获取按键不兼容处理
- Ajax 获取XmlHttpRequest对象
- Ajax -- 获取XMLHttpRequest对象
- Ajax 中 XMLHttpRequest对象的方法与属性
- 浏览器兼容获取XmlHttpRequest对象
- js获取鼠标点击的位置-火狐IE兼容
- 兼容IE火狐的回车
- phpstorm 9.0最新 注册码亲测可用注册码
- 遍历二叉树
- java:水仙花数打印
- 类和对象浅谈(1)
- [PAT]1102. Invert a Binary Tree (25)
- Ajax获取XmlHttpRequest对象的方法,兼容IE、火狐。用来与服务器进行通信。
- Scala学习笔记02【数组、列表、元组、集合和映射】
- Permutations II
- 回答“为什么跳槽”
- C#编程思想及C#类型/运算符和强制类型转换
- Objective-C占位符(转载)
- 黑马程序员——Java语言:正则、反射
- JAVA中文字符编码问题详解
- 实习期间初次使用javascript调用webserver,将html页面提交